A desert receives less than 10 inches of rain on average per year. Semi-desert receives over 10 inches but less than about 20 inches.

What is the difference between hot deserts and semi deserts?

A desert receives less than 10 inches (250 mm) of precipitation per year on average. A semi-arid region usually receives between 10 and 20 inches (500 mm) of precipitation per year on average and are frequently grasslands.


What is the difference between semiarid and arid?

Semi-desert means semi-arid. A desert receives less than 10 inches (250 mm) of annual precipitation on average. A semi-arid region receives between 10 inches (250 mm) and 20 inches (500 mm) of precipitation per year.
